About STATION CREEK RETIREMENT COMMUNITY INC

Station Creek Retirement Community, Inc. is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it that operates a 49-unit, HUD-subsidized senior rental community serving low-income older adults in the Grand Rapids/Caledonia area. The organization is part of the Porter Hills / Brio family of affordable housing communities and is structured to operate under HUD Section 202/PRAC program rules. In the most recent publicly reported fiscal year (FY2024) Station Creek continued regular Form 990 filings and reported program-driven revenues and multi‑million dollars in total assets as part of consolidated reporting within the Porter Hills/Brio network.
